Transaction d5628edde95c3a0f7feb65009aa46011f4938c5c018b0137234f23e4bcf47f7e
1 Input
1 Output
-
d5628edde95c3a0f7feb65009aa46011f4938c5c018b0137234f23e4bcf47f7e:0
- value
- 17346890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04d7ddf04cfa544cb446ff4a0d1a95db853fbb88 OP_EQUAL
- address
- M8LmXtvPcBosGfNynNLYbTmn91eTX9j9yF